Bill Gates Keynote Gets The Blue Screen Of Death

No news isn't always good news, and Bill Gates didn't have much to say at last night's keynote address: nothing new about the XBox, and he pushed his lovefest with TiVo and the slowly-developing plans for digital media transfers between storage and players. Best of all:

The presentation was marred by several technical glitches, including a Windows XP Media Center slide show that couldn't be launched and an Xbox game demonstration that abruptly ended with a blue-screen memory error.
